KiwiQA and DigitSec Partner to Enhance Salesforce Application Security

SYDNEY - Washingtoner -- KiwiQA, a leader in best-in-class testing and validation of Salesforce implementations, has recognized the critical need for a robust Salesforce application security solution partner. To address this need, the company has chosen DigitSec as their partner. This newly formed partnership between KiwiQA and DigitSec is set to deliver exceptional value to customers by enhancing Salesforce application security and expanding their capabilities to help lower the overall cost of Salesforce application implementations.

The DigitSec platform enables cybersecurity teams and developers to easily identify security vulnerabilities and recommend corrective actions before deployment, allowing for the faster delivery of secure applications. Applicable to any industry and organization size, the DigitSec platform is particularly beneficial for regulated industries.

"The need for Salesforce application security is rapidly evolving into a business necessity," said Adrian Szwarcburg, Senior Vice President of Business Development at DigitSec. As organizations rely on Salesforce to help run their business, application development has become complex and contains vulnerabilities. Our partnership with KiwiQA will allow them to offer comprehensive Salesforce code and configuration security testing to ensure their customers are as secure as possible from hackers.

Niranjan Limbachiya, CEO of KiwiQA, added, "Partnering with DigitSec aligns perfectly with our mission to deliver top-notch quality assurance and testing services. This collaboration not only strengthens our service offerings but also ensures our clients have access to the best-in-class security solutions for their Salesforce applications. We are excited about the potential this partnership holds for enhancing our clients' confidence in their application security."

About DigitSec

DigitSec is a comprehensive SaaS security platform for Salesforce application development, designed to help identify vulnerabilities and mitigate risk. With DigitSec, cybersecurity and development teams can overcome the challenges of balancing security with functionality and deadlines to deliver secure, business-critical Salesforce applications. The platform is easy-to-use, intuitive, and proactive, quickly identifying Salesforce application vulnerabilities. It is highly flexible to meet the demanding needs of admins, project managers, and developers. Some of the world's largest system integrators and Fortune 2000 companies rely on DigitSec to secure their Salesforce application development. DigitSec is SOC 2 Type 2 compliant, making it an ideal partner for regulated industries. For more information, visit https://www.digitsec.com.

About KiwiQA

KiwiQA is a leading provider of quality assurance and testing services, specializing in Salesforce implementation testing and validation. With a focus on delivering high-quality, reliable testing solutions, KiwiQA helps businesses ensure their Salesforce applications are secure, functional, and ready for deployment. By partnering with DigitSec, KiwiQA enhances its ability to provide comprehensive security testing services, ensuring that their customers are protected from potential vulnerabilities and threats.
